Or are you talking about the seals on the transmission input shaft right behind the Power Director clutch pack? If you want to keep the transmission and PD fluids separate, it might be important... Some folks leave these out and treat the transmission, PD, and hydraulic compartments as one. If you have a PD filter like the Series 3 and later, that's probably OK, but I might be nervous about clutch pack shavings getting into the hydraulic system.
